Job description: Description :Role Impact:The Specialist – Marketing Digital Email will bring experience and passion to lead and build our digital channels to connect with our customers everyday with relevant, engaging content and communications.Overall, as part of the digital team, this role will play a part in managing digital campaigns and help to build strategy across the digital channels for all properties.You will be responsible for planning and testing on your respective digital channels, formats and content communications and track to optimize performance KPIs specifically on digital.On the Digital team, it will be important to support the digital channels and more specifically:
- Email: help to drive email strategy, process and implementation and bring to life our marketing and content via email to deliver the optimal experience for our CF Insider community members. You will work to develop email trigger campaigns and leverage insights to build out audience groups to deliver a more personalized newsletter experience across all of our campaigns.
This role requires the successful candidate to be in the office 4 days per week.What you will deliver:
- Gather data on consumer and digital channel insights, competitive analysis and other relevant ideas and innovation to work with Manager – Digital to inform and build out strategy on the digital platforms for every day and seasonal campaigns.
- Solicit property specific content, incorporate review from MarCom and then optimize execution on the digital channels, in collaboration with Experience and Delivery.
- Brief the MarCom and Design team on the digital creative needs and ensure assets are optimized for digital channels.
- Execute a data driven, test and learn approach to digital marketing across all digital platforms.
- Track, monitor and report key KPI performance at regular intervals for ongoing digital optimizations and data driven decision making.
- Build and maintain email delivery process with a high attention to detail and collaboration to drive efficiency in cross functional approvals and ensure high level of quality and accuracy.
- Work closely with the Business Intelligence team and external agency to build out audience segmentation lists customized and develop automated trigger campaigns based on customer insights to deliver a more personalized customer experience.
- Continually test and optimize key email components such as subject lines, timing, creative layouts, segmentation, frequency and more.
- Collaborate with Business Intelligence and our external agency to monitor database health and ensure all technical aspects of email are functioning.

Job description: Description :Role impact:To become a key and influential member of an existing property management team while gaining experience and knowledge required to become a General Manager, and assist the General Manager in overseeing every aspect of the property.What you will deliver:
- Manage the activities of all direct reports to ensure the timely achievement of department goals, within prescribed policies, procedures and standard business practices
- Provide leadership to all team members when the GM is absent or as required by the business
- Work closely with Operations, Marketing and Security & Life Safety Managers to ensure effective execution of all operational programs and ensure effective communication practices are developed and implemented
- Provide regular motivation and mentoring to all staff to encourage ongoing professional development for succession planning purposes
- Monitor expenses on a monthly basis by reviewing actual performance against budget and conducting a monthly variance analysis to determine reasons for variance and recommend methods to the General Manager to address the situation in order to ensure expenditures remain within prescribed budgets
- Assist the General Manager in ensuring that all programs related to the overall operation of the Centre are implemented in a timely efficient manner by regularly reviewing the execution of areas such as, but not limited to, marketing, preventative maintenance, energy management, environmental management, waste management, landscaping, pest control, property security, snow removal, parking lot and roof maintenance and rehabilitation, life safety systems, cleaning operations, tenant coordination, and Health & Safety to ensure cost effective facility management in compliance with all relevant legislation
- Lead key business projects, processes or procedures as identified by the GM and as needed by the business
- Assist the GM in developing the annual operating budget for all categories of expense and recovery by conducting thorough studies of all contracts, previous year’s budget, repairs and upgrades and by controlling expenses
- Assist in maintaining accounts receivable at a minimum level through weekly reviews with the revenue coordinator and immediately initiating any necessary paperwork to ensure CF retains good cash flow and limits exposure to delinquent accounts
- Support in the development and implementation of strategies for increasing sales performance and maximizing revenue
- Assist in the promotion and roll out of various plans to assist and guide in meeting corporate and portfolio vision, mission and goals
- Respond to after-hours emergency calls by going to the site and taking the actions required to ensure all emergency procedures are followed and the security of personnel and the property is maintained as required
